Help! Facelift Rear on 2007 model
Hi everyone,
I have a chance to purchase a facelift rear bumper and the new OEM LED rear lights at a bargain price £400. The bumper is already the same colour so no need to respray. (save a bit of cash)
Is there any difficulties installing these mods? How are the fittings? is the LED plug and play? or do I need resisters as the voltage is different?
As I have quad exhaust set up on my w204, do I just buy a new rear c63 diffuser?
Any help appreciated.
Don't have much time so please reply asap.
Thank you all very much.

Yes you will need a new diffuser and I do think the 2012 C63 diffuser would work for your quad tips.
As far as the lights, yes, you do need reprogramming. If you have a 2008 or 2009 car, you can have the SAM reprogramed to make it look just like the 2012:
https://mbworld.org/forums/c-class-w...am-module.html
Recently a member on here has found a way to get the lights to work properly with a custom modification, but there has been much debate on it not being the right way, as you can see here, I guess as of now its the only way to get the lights to work with no error messages on 2010 and 2011 cars:
